Method
Preparation
- Select your onion variety and cut them into rings.
- Dust the onion rings with seasoned flour to absorb moisture.
- Prepare an egg wash by beating the eggs; mix in buttermilk or hot sauce for extra flavor.
- Coat the floured onion rings in the egg wash.
- Finally, coat the onion rings with panko breadcrumbs.
Cooking
- Preheat the air fryer to 400°F.
- Place the coated onion rings in the air fryer basket in a single layer.
- Cook for 10-12 minutes or until golden and crispy, shaking the basket halfway through.
Serving
- Serve hot with your choice of dipping sauces such as spicy mayo, classic ranch, or tangy BBQ glaze.
